Zechariah 2:1-8 Amplified Bible (AMP)

1. AND I lifted up my eyes and saw, and behold, a man with a measuring line in his hand.

2. Then said I, Where are you going? And he said to me, To measure Jerusalem, to see what is its breadth and what is its length.

3. And behold, the angel who talked with me went forth and another angel went out to meet him,

4. And he said to the second angel, Run, speak to this young man, saying, Jerusalem shall be inhabited and dwell as villages without walls, because of the multitude of people and livestock in it.

5. For I, says the Lord, will be to her a wall of fire round about, and I will be the glory in the midst of her.

6. Ho! ho! [Hear and] flee from the land of the north, says the Lord, and from the four winds of the heavens, for to them have I scattered you, says the Lord.

7. Ho! Escape to Zion, you who dwell with the daughter of Babylon!

8. For thus said the Lord of hosts, after [His] glory had sent me [His messenger] to the nations who plundered you–for he who touches you touches the apple or pupil of His eye:
